#b35add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b35add is composed of 70.2% red, 35.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 61%. #b35add color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b4ff with #6700b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b35add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b35add has RGB values of R:179, G:90,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 11754205.

Hex triplet b35add #b35add
RGB Decimal 179, 90, 221 rgb(179,90,221)
RGB Percent 70.2, 35.3, 86.7 rgb(70.2%,35.3%,86.7%)
CMYK 19, 59, 0, 13
HSL 280.8°, 65.8, 61 hsl(280.8,65.8%,61%)
HSV (or HSB) 280.8°, 59.3, 86.7
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 54.152, 57.013, -52.328
XYZ 35.296, 22.118, 70.812
xyY 0.275, 0.172, 22.118
CIE-LCH 54.152, 77.387, 317.453
CIE-LUV 54.152, 32.236, -87.88
Hunter-Lab 47.029, 51.665, -56.353
Binary 10110011, 01011010, 11011101

Shades and Tints of #b35add

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.
